PET Plastic Bottle

The 25-ounce PET (polyethylene terephthalate) bottle is favored for its lightweight and clarity, making it ideal for beverages, personal care, and pharmaceutical liquids. Its high recyclability and ability to be molded into various shapes provide flexible branding opportunities. B2B buyers should prioritize sourcing from reputable suppliers to ensure consistent quality, especially for food-grade certifications and closure compatibility. PET bottles are suitable for both bulk distribution and retail, but they are less suited for hot fill applications due to heat sensitivity.

HDPE Plastic Bottle

High-density polyethylene (HDPE) bottles are known for their durability, chemical resistance, and opacity. They are commonly used for industrial chemicals, household cleaners, and sanitizers, where impact resistance and chemical barrier properties are critical. For B2B buyers, key considerations include mold customization options for private labeling and ensuring the material meets relevant safety standards. While less visually appealing for premium branding, HDPE’s robustness makes it a reliable choice for heavy-duty applications, especially in regions with challenging logistics.

Glass Bottle

Glass bottles are the go-to for premium products such as perfumes, essential oils, and luxury beverages. Their inert nature preserves product integrity and conveys a high-end image, aligning with European and Middle Eastern market preferences. However, glass’s weight and fragility increase shipping costs and require specialized export packaging. Buyers should work with experienced suppliers who can provide secure, impact-resistant packaging solutions to minimize breakage during transit, especially when sourcing for international markets.

Stainless Steel Bottle

Although less common at the 25-ounce size, stainless steel bottles are gaining popularity for eco-conscious and premium branding. Their insulation capability makes them suitable for health drinks, energy shots, or travel kits. These bottles are highly durable, reusable, and resistant to corrosion, making them an environmentally friendly option. B2B buyers should evaluate minimum order quantities, branding methods like laser etching, and compliance with food safety standards. They are especially attractive in urban European markets where sustainability is prioritized.

Dropper Bottle

Dropper bottles are designed for precise dispensing of liquids such as pharmaceuticals, essential oils, or laboratory samples. Made from PET, glass, or HDPE, they typically feature child-resistant caps and tinted finishes for UV protection. These bottles are critical for industries requiring accurate dosing and product integrity. When sourcing, buyers should verify the accuracy of the dropper mechanism, compatibility with product viscosity, and regulatory compliance, particularly for markets in Europe and Latin America where safety standards are stringent.

Strategic Material Selection Guide for 25 ounce bottle

Material Analysis for 25 Ounce Bottles: Key Properties and B2B Considerations

Selecting the appropriate material for 25 ounce bottles requires a comprehensive understanding of the physical, chemical, and regulatory characteristics that influence product performance, cost, and supply chain logistics. Here, we analyze four common materials—PET plastic, HDPE plastic, glass, and stainless steel—each offering distinct advantages and limitations from a B2B perspective.

PET Plastic

Polyethylene terephthalate (PET) is the most prevalent material for large-volume bottles due to its lightweight, clarity, and recyclability. PET bottles are highly versatile, allowing for extensive customization in shape, color, and neck finish, which supports branding and product differentiation. They perform well with a wide range of liquids, especially non-hot-filled products, and are resistant to impact and shattering, reducing breakage during transit.

Pros: Cost-effective, easy to produce at scale, recyclable, transparent for product visibility, compatible with various closure types.
Cons: Limited temperature resistance—hot fills above 60°C can deform the bottle; susceptible to stress cracking with certain chemicals; less suitable for highly reactive or aggressive media.
Impact on Application: Ideal for beverages, cosmetics, and some pharmaceuticals, provided the media are compatible. Not suitable for hot-fill or carbonated products without specialized formulations.
International B2B Considerations: Reputable suppliers adhering to ASTM D6400 or European EN 13432 standards are preferred. Buyers in Africa, South America, and the Middle East should verify local recycling infrastructure and ensure compliance with regional food safety standards like CODEX or local health authorities. Custom molds and colorants should meet regulatory requirements to facilitate import clearance.

HDPE Plastic

High-density polyethylene (HDPE) is renowned for its chemical resistance and durability. Opaque and sturdy, HDPE bottles are well-suited for chemicals, cleaning agents, and personal care products that require high barrier properties. They withstand a broad temperature range, making them suitable for hot fills and certain sterilization processes.

Pros: Excellent chemical resistance, high impact strength, UV stability, and good barrier properties.
Cons: Opaque appearance limits branding and product visibility; more difficult to customize in complex shapes; generally higher cost than PET.
Impact on Application: Suitable for industrial chemicals, sanitizers, and medicinal liquids requiring chemical inertness and robustness. Not ideal for products where transparency or aesthetic appeal is a priority.
International B2B Considerations: Suppliers should meet DIN 16887 or ASTM D3350 standards. Buyers should confirm compliance with regional regulations such as REACH in Europe or local chemical safety standards. Compatibility with closure systems and mold customization options are critical for private labeling in diverse markets.

Glass

Glass offers an inert, premium packaging solution, especially valued in luxury, pharmaceutical, and specialty food sectors. Its transparency and impermeability preserve product integrity and enhance perceived quality. Glass bottles are highly recyclable and align with sustainability goals prevalent in European and Middle Eastern markets.

Pros: Inert, non-reactive, reusable, premium aesthetic, excellent barrier to gases and odors.
Cons: Heavy and fragile, increasing shipping and handling costs; higher manufacturing complexity; potential for breakage during transit.
Impact on Application: Best suited for perfumes, essential oils, high-end beverages, and specialty foods where product integrity and presentation are paramount.
International B2B Considerations: Suppliers must comply with ISO 9001 standards and export safety regulations. Buyers should consider local import restrictions, transportation logistics, and the need for specialized packaging to prevent breakage. Certification for food contact safety (e.g., FDA, EU food safety standards) is essential.

Stainless Steel

Though less common in the 25-ounce size, stainless steel bottles are gaining popularity for premium, eco-friendly, and reusable applications. They are highly durable, corrosion-resistant, and provide excellent insulation, making them ideal for travel kits, health drinks, and promotional items.

Pros: Reusable, corrosion-resistant, environmentally friendly, excellent insulation properties, modern aesthetic.
Cons: Higher initial cost, limited transparency, manufacturing complexity, and potential weight considerations.
Impact on Application: Suitable for high-end gifts, travel, and health-focused products where durability and brand image are priorities.
International B2B Considerations: Suppliers should meet standards like ASTM A240 or EN 10088. Buyers must evaluate minimum order quantities, branding options (laser etching, coatings), and regulatory certifications for food or beverage use, especially in markets with strict health and safety standards like Europe and the Middle East.


Summary Table of Material Attributes for 25 Ounce Bottles

Material Typical Use Case for 25 ounce bottle Key Advantage Key Disadvantage/Limitation Relative Cost (Low/Med/High)
PET Plastic Beverages, cosmetics, non-hot-filled products Cost-effective, lightweight, customizable, recyclable Limited hot-fill resistance, stress cracking potential Low
HDPE Plastic Chemicals, sanitizers, industrial liquids Chemical resistance, impact strength, UV stability Opaque, less aesthetic flexibility Med
Glass Perfumes, premium beverages, specialty foods Inert, premium appearance, reusable Heavy, fragile, higher shipping costs High
Stainless Steel Travel kits, health drinks, promotional items Durable, insulated, eco-friendly Costly, limited transparency, heavier High

In-depth Look: Manufacturing Processes and Quality Assurance for 25 ounce bottle

Manufacturing Processes for 25 Ounce Bottles

Producing high-quality 25 ounce bottles requires a well-structured manufacturing process, encompassing several critical stages that ensure consistency, functionality, and compliance with international standards. For B2B buyers, understanding these stages helps in assessing supplier capabilities and ensuring product integrity across markets.

Material Preparation and Selection

The manufacturing process begins with selecting appropriate raw materials based on the bottle type and application. Common materials include PET, HDPE, glass, or stainless steel. Suppliers must source materials compliant with relevant food, pharmaceutical, or cosmetic standards, such as FDA or EU regulations. Material certification (e.g., Certificates of Compliance or Analysis) should be verified prior to production to prevent contamination and ensure safety.

Pre-Processing and Material Conditioning

Raw materials are conditioned to optimal processing temperatures and moisture levels. For plastics, this involves drying and melting processes to eliminate moisture that could cause defects like bubbles or weak spots. For glass, batch mixing and melting in high-temperature furnaces are essential, with precise control to achieve uniform viscosity.

Forming and Molding

Plastic bottles: The most common forming method is Injection Blow Molding (IBM) or Extrusion Blow Molding (EBM). In IBM, preforms are injection-molded and then reheated and blown into molds. EBM involves extruding hollow parisons that are subsequently inflated to match molds. This process allows for high-volume, consistent production with tight dimensional tolerances.

Glass bottles: Formed via blow and blow or press and blow techniques. Molten glass is either pressed into molds or blown into molds using compressed air, creating the desired shape. Precision in temperature control and mold design is vital for uniform thickness and clarity.

Stainless steel bottles: Manufacturing often involves precision machining or metal stamping, followed by welding and surface finishing. The process emphasizes durability and insulation features, with strict control over wall thickness and seam integrity.

Assembly and Finishing

For bottles with additional features—such as integrated droppers, caps, or decorative elements—assembly involves attaching these components using ultrasonic welding, heat sealing, or threading. Finishing steps include trimming excess material, surface polishing, and applying decoration or branding through laser etching or labeling.

Quality surface finishes are crucial, particularly for premium markets. Suppliers may employ surface treatments to improve scratch resistance or aesthetic appeal, especially for glass and stainless steel bottles.

Quality Control (QC) Standards and Industry Regulations

Ensuring the quality of 25 ounce bottles involves rigorous inspection and testing aligned with international standards, industry-specific certifications, and client-specific requirements.

International Standards and Certifications

  • ISO 9001: The cornerstone of quality management systems, ISO 9001 certification indicates that a manufacturer adheres to internationally recognized quality procedures, emphasizing customer satisfaction, process consistency, and continuous improvement.
  • ISO 22000 / HACCP: For food-grade bottles, these standards address safety hazards and control measures throughout the manufacturing process.
  • CE Marking: For products exported to Europe, compliance with CE directives ensures conformity with safety, health, and environmental requirements.
  • API and other industry-specific standards: For bottles used in specialized sectors like chemicals or pharmaceuticals, adherence to standards such as API (American Petroleum Institute) or pharmacopeial requirements is critical.

QC Checkpoints and Testing Methods

1. Incoming Quality Control (IQC):
Raw materials undergo detailed inspection upon receipt. Tests include dimensional verification, material composition analysis via spectroscopy, and checking for contaminants or defects. Suppliers should provide detailed test reports and certificates.

2. In-Process Quality Control (IPQC):
During manufacturing, critical parameters such as temperature, pressure, and cycle times are monitored. Dimensional checks are performed using coordinate measuring machines (CMM) or optical comparators. Visual inspections for surface defects, flash, or warping are routine.

3. Final Quality Control (FQC):
Post-production, bottles are subjected to comprehensive testing:
Leak Testing: Using pressure or vacuum methods to ensure hermetic seals.
Drop and Impact Tests: To verify durability.
Transparency and Clarity Checks: For glass and plastic bottles, ensuring visual standards.
Label and Finish Inspection: Confirming branding accuracy and surface quality.
Chemical Compatibility: Testing for leaching or contamination, especially for pharmaceutical and food applications.

4. Specialized Testing:
Depending on the application, tests such as UV resistance, chemical resistance, or thermal stability are conducted. For example, bottles intended for hot-fill liquids require high-temperature testing to confirm structural integrity.

How B2B Buyers Can Verify Supplier Quality

Audits and Inspections:
Conduct on-site audits or hire third-party inspection agencies to evaluate manufacturing facilities, quality systems, and production capabilities. This is especially vital for buyers in Africa, South America, and the Middle East, where local supplier standards may vary.

Inspection Reports and Certification Verification:
Request detailed inspection reports, test certificates, and process documentation. Cross-verify certifications like ISO 9001, ISO 22000, CE, or industry-specific standards through issuing bodies or accreditation agencies.

Sample Testing and Pilot Orders:
Prior to large-scale procurement, order samples for independent testing. This verifies that the supplier’s quality meets specified standards and that bottles perform under real-world conditions.

Third-Party Inspection & Certification:
Engage reputable third-party inspection services such as SGS, Bureau Veritas, or Intertek. These agencies assess conformity, conduct random sampling, and provide unbiased quality reports.

Quality Assurance Nuances for International B2B Buyers

Regional Regulatory Requirements:
Buyers from diverse regions must ensure supplier compliance with local regulations—such as the EU’s REACH, Brazil’s ANVISA standards, or Turkey’s TSE requirements. This may involve additional testing for chemical residues, labeling, or packaging safety.

Cultural and Logistical Considerations:
Suppliers may vary in their understanding of specific regional standards. International buyers should specify detailed technical specifications and request documentation in local languages if necessary. Consider logistical factors like packaging integrity during transit, especially for fragile glass or heavy stainless steel bottles.

Supplier Certifications and Continuous Improvement:
Establish ongoing quality assurance programs, including supplier audits and periodic re-evaluations. Building relationships with certified suppliers who demonstrate consistent quality reduces risks associated with counterfeit or substandard products.

Comprehensive Cost and Pricing Analysis for 25 ounce bottle Sourcing

Cost Structure Breakdown for 25 Ounce Bottles

Understanding the comprehensive cost components involved in sourcing 25 ounce bottles is crucial for effective price negotiation and strategic procurement. The primary expenses include raw materials, manufacturing labor, overhead costs, tooling, quality control, logistics, and profit margins.

Materials:
The choice of material significantly influences cost. PET plastics tend to be the most economical, especially when purchased in bulk, with prices typically ranging from USD 0.10 to USD 0.25 per bottle for standard quality. Glass bottles are more expensive, often costing between USD 0.50 and USD 1.50 each due to raw material and manufacturing complexity. For premium or specialized materials like stainless steel, costs can escalate to USD 3–6 per unit, reflecting durability and branding value.

Labor and Manufacturing Overhead:
Labor costs vary widely depending on the manufacturing location. Suppliers in Turkey, China, or Eastern Europe often have lower labor expenses compared to European or North American plants. Overhead costs—covering machinery maintenance, energy, and plant expenses—are embedded in unit prices and can range from 10-30% of the raw material costs.

Tooling and Setup Fees:
Initial tooling costs for custom molds or design modifications can be substantial, often ranging from USD 2,000 to USD 10,000 depending on complexity. These are typically amortized over large production runs, reducing the unit cost significantly for high-volume orders.

Quality Control and Certifications:
Ensuring compliance with international standards (such as FDA, ISO, or CE certifications) incurs additional costs. Suppliers with robust QC processes may charge premium prices, but this investment mitigates risks associated with non-compliance, product recalls, or market rejection—particularly critical for pharmaceutical or food-grade bottles.

Logistics and Incoterms:
Shipping costs are a major variable influenced by destination, order volume, and mode of transportation. FOB (Free on Board) terms generally place responsibility on the buyer for inland freight, while CIF (Cost, Insurance, Freight) includes shipping and insurance, simplifying procurement but increasing upfront costs. For buyers in Africa, South America, or the Middle East, freight charges can range from USD 0.10 to USD 0.50 per bottle depending on volume and distance.

Margins and Markup:
Suppliers typically add a markup of 15–30% to cover operational costs and profit. Larger volume orders often attract better pricing, with discounts starting at 20,000+ units, emphasizing the importance of volume commitments.


Price Influencers and Market Dynamics

  • Volume & MOQ:
    Higher order volumes reduce per-unit costs, with MOQ thresholds often starting around 10,000 units for standard bottles. Buyers should leverage volume negotiations to secure discounts or better lead times.

  • Customization & Specifications:
    Tailored designs, unique neck finishes, or specialized materials increase costs—sometimes by 20–50%. Clear communication on specifications early in the sourcing process can prevent costly rework.

  • Material & Quality Certifications:
    Premium materials and strict quality standards (e.g., food-grade, pharma-grade) command higher prices but are essential for compliance in regulated markets like Europe and North America.

  • Supplier Factors:
    Reputation, lead times, and capacity influence pricing. Established suppliers with proven quality records might command premiums but offer greater reliability and faster turnaround.

  • Incoterms & Shipping:
    Negotiating favorable Incoterms (like FOB or DDP) can significantly impact total landed costs. Buyers should consider the total cost of ownership, including customs duties, taxes, and inland transportation.


Strategic Tips for International B2B Buyers

  • Negotiate for Volume Discounts & Flexible MOQ:
    Leverage your projected order volume to negotiate better unit prices, especially if you can commit to long-term partnerships.

  • Assess Total Cost of Ownership (TCO):
    Factor in not just unit price but also logistics, customs, storage, and potential rework costs. Sometimes, paying a premium for higher quality or faster delivery reduces downstream expenses.

  • Prioritize Certifications & Compliance:
    Partner with suppliers who can provide necessary certifications to avoid costly delays or market rejections, especially in Europe and North America.

  • Build Relationships & Long-Term Contracts:
    Establishing trust and consistent demand can lead to better pricing, priority production slots, and streamlined communication.

  • Stay Informed on Market Trends:
    Monitor shifts toward sustainable materials and innovative packaging, which may influence costs and supplier options over time.


Disclaimer

Indicative prices provided here serve as a general reference; actual costs vary depending on supplier negotiations, order quantities, regional factors, and specific customization requirements. Engaging in thorough supplier due diligence and requesting detailed quotations is essential for precise budgeting.

Essential Technical Properties and Trade Terminology for 25 ounce bottle

Critical Technical Properties of 25 Ounce Bottles

  • Material Grade: The choice of material—such as PET, HDPE, glass, or stainless steel—must meet specific industry standards (e.g., FDA compliance for food contact, pharmaceutical-grade certifications). Higher-grade materials ensure product safety, durability, and regulatory compliance, which are crucial for market acceptance in regions like Europe and North America.

  • Tolerance Levels: Tolerance refers to the permissible deviation in dimensions such as bottle height, diameter, and wall thickness during manufacturing. Maintaining tight tolerances (typically ±0.2 mm) guarantees consistent filling, compatibility with closures, and seamless automation, reducing operational disruptions and ensuring quality uniformity across batches.

  • Neck Finish and Closure Compatibility: The neck finish—the threading or sealing surface—is standardized to ensure compatibility with various caps and dispensing systems. Industry standards like ISO or specific regional specifications (e.g., European or North American) facilitate seamless integration with closure components, critical for leak-proof packaging and regulatory compliance.

  • Wall Thickness and Strength: Adequate wall thickness ensures the bottle withstands internal pressure, handling, and transportation stresses without deformation or failure. Strength properties influence drop resistance, stacking stability, and overall product integrity, especially important for fragile glass or lightweight plastics designed for international shipping.

  • Recyclability and Sustainability Certifications: Increasing global emphasis on eco-friendly packaging requires bottles to be produced from recyclable materials with recognized certifications (e.g., EU Ecolabel, ASTM standards). These properties impact market acceptance, especially in regions with strict environmental regulations like Europe and parts of South America.

  • Barrier Properties: For bottles containing sensitive contents—such as pharmaceuticals or essential oils—barrier properties like oxygen and UV resistance are vital. These ensure product stability and shelf life, aligning with industry standards and consumer safety expectations across different regions.

Common Trade and Industry Terms

  • OEM (Original Equipment Manufacturer): An OEM produces bottles based on specifications provided by the buyer, often for private-label branding. Understanding OEM relationships helps buyers tailor product features, quality standards, and lead times, especially when sourcing from overseas suppliers.

  • MOQ (Minimum Order Quantity): The smallest quantity a supplier will accept for production. Knowledge of MOQ is essential for planning procurement budgets and managing inventory, particularly in regions where small batch testing is common, such as South America or the Middle East.

  • RFQ (Request for Quotation): A formal process where buyers solicit price quotes, technical specifications, and lead times from multiple suppliers. Effectively issuing RFQs enables comparative analysis, negotiation leverage, and ensures sourcing aligns with regional regulatory requirements.

  • Incoterms (International Commercial Terms): Standardized trade terms (e.g., FOB, CIF, DDP) that define responsibilities, costs, and risks during shipping. Familiarity with Incoterms helps international buyers clarify delivery obligations, customs duties, and insurance, facilitating smoother cross-border transactions.

  • Private Labeling: The process of branding bottles with a buyer’s logo and design, often used in retail or promotional contexts. Understanding private labeling options allows buyers in diverse markets like Africa and Europe to tailor packaging to local consumer preferences and regulatory branding mandates.

  • Certifications: Industry-standard compliance marks (e.g., ISO, CE, FDA) that verify safety, quality, and environmental standards. Recognizing relevant certifications ensures products meet regional legal requirements, reducing customs delays and market entry barriers.

Frequently Asked Questions (FAQs) for B2B Buyers of 25 ounce bottle

1. How can I effectively vet suppliers of 25-ounce bottles to ensure quality and reliability?

To vet international suppliers effectively, start by requesting comprehensive certifications such as ISO 9001, GMP, or specific food-grade, pharma-grade, or environmental standards relevant to your product. Review their quality control processes, including inspection reports, batch testing, and material sourcing documentation. Check references or request client testimonials, especially from buyers in your region or similar markets. Visit their facilities if possible or arrange third-party audits to verify manufacturing capabilities, cleanliness, and compliance. Additionally, assess their communication responsiveness, lead times, and willingness to customize—these are indicators of reliability.

2. What customization options are typically available for 25-ounce bottles, and how do they impact lead times and costs?

Suppliers often offer customization in bottle shape, color, neck finish, closure types, and labeling or printing. Some may provide bespoke molds for unique designs, which can significantly enhance brand differentiation. However, customization usually increases lead times—often by 4-8 weeks—and adds tooling costs, especially for complex molds. For cost efficiency, consider standard shapes with minimal modifications. Communicate your exact specifications early and request detailed quotations, including tooling fees, minimum order quantities (MOQs), and lead times, to align production schedules with your market rollout plans.

3. What are typical minimum order quantities, lead times, and payment terms for importing 25-ounce bottles internationally?

Most suppliers set MOQs ranging from 10,000 to 50,000 units, depending on complexity and customization level. Lead times generally span 6-12 weeks from order confirmation, influenced by mold creation, material availability, and factory capacity. Payment terms often include 30% upfront via wire transfer or letter of credit, with the balance payable before shipment or upon delivery. Some suppliers may offer flexible arrangements for repeat orders or larger volumes. Establish clear contractual terms, including penalties for delays, to safeguard your supply chain.

4. What quality assurance measures and certifications should I verify before importing 25-ounce bottles?

Ensure your supplier provides relevant certifications such as ISO 22000, ISO 9001, or industry-specific standards like FDA compliance for food-grade bottles or CE marking for certain materials. Request detailed quality assurance protocols, including raw material testing, in-process inspections, and final batch certification. Verify the supplier’s ability to provide test reports for key parameters like chemical composition, leak resistance, and safety compliance. For sensitive applications—pharmaceuticals or cosmetics—additional certifications like GMP, GMP+ or specific country approvals (e.g., EU REACH) are essential.

5. How should I plan logistics and shipping when importing 25-ounce bottles to regions like Africa, South America, or the Middle East?

Coordinate with suppliers experienced in international freight, opting for sea freight for large volumes due to cost efficiency, or air freight for urgent needs. Select reliable freight forwarders with expertise in handling fragile items like bottles, ensuring proper packaging and labeling. Clarify incoterms (e.g., FOB, CIF) to understand responsibilities and costs. Be mindful of regional import regulations, tariffs, and customs clearance procedures—partnering with local customs brokers can streamline this process. Consider warehousing options near your target markets for faster distribution.

6. How can I resolve disputes related to quality, delivery delays, or contractual disagreements with international suppliers?

Establish clear contractual agreements that specify quality standards, inspection rights, lead times, and dispute resolution mechanisms before placing orders. In case of disputes, initiate communication through formal channels, documenting issues with photographs and inspection reports. Engage third-party inspectors or arbitration services if necessary, especially in jurisdictions with strong legal frameworks like Europe or Turkey. Maintaining open dialogue and fostering collaborative problem-solving often yields quicker resolutions. Always include clauses for penalties or refunds if contractual terms are breached, and consider legal counsel familiar with international trade laws.

7. What are the key factors to consider when selecting eco-friendly or sustainable 25-ounce bottles for export markets?

Prioritize suppliers offering certified recyclable, biodegradable, or compostable materials such as PET with high recyclability or glass. Verify their sourcing practices, ensuring raw materials are responsibly obtained and compliant with environmental standards like EU REACH or US EPA regulations. Evaluate the supplier’s ability to provide eco-labeling or documentation demonstrating sustainability claims. Consider the entire lifecycle—transportation weight impacts carbon footprint, so opt for lightweight designs. Communicate your sustainability goals clearly to ensure the supplier aligns with your branding and compliance needs.

8. How do I handle potential product liability or regulatory issues when importing bottles into different markets?

Understand the regulatory landscape of your target market—EU, Brazil, Turkey, etc.—and ensure your bottles meet local standards for safety, labeling, and material composition. Work with suppliers who can provide relevant compliance documentation and test reports. Incorporate quality control checkpoints during production and before shipment. Obtain necessary import permits and certifications from local authorities. For high-risk or sensitive products, consider consulting with local legal or regulatory experts to preempt compliance issues, reducing the risk of product recalls, fines, or shipment delays.
